On the characterization of the SU(3)-subgroups of type C and D

Abstract

We investigate the two classes of finite subgroups of SU(3) that are called type C and D in the book of Miller, Blichfeldt and Dickson. We present two theorems which fully determine the form of the generators in a suitable basis. After exploring further properties of these groups, we are able to construct a complete list of infinite series in which these groups are arranged. For type C there are infinitely many series whereas for type D there are only two. Explicit examples of these series are presented which illustrate the general results.
